What Is the Cost of Living Near Colorado Springs?

Understanding the cost of living near Colorado Springs is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Aventa Credit Union.
Colorado Springs' Cost of Living Index is approximately 100.9 (0.9% more expensive than US average; 4.2% less than CO average). Military presence (Air Force Academy, Fort Carson), housing near US avg, scenic. When planning your budget based on a salary from Aventa Credit Union, consider these typical monthly expenses:
